Mo Products: A Deep Analysis Concerning Performance

Molybdenum products offer outstanding performance across a extensive range of applications|fields. Their unique combination of high strength, corrosion resistance, and thermal stability makes them ideal for demanding environments. Specifically, in the chemical processing industry, molybdenum alloys provide remarkable durability when facing aggressive chemical attack and high temperatures|corrosive conditions. Furthermore, in the aerospace sector, molybdenum components contribute to improved engine efficiency and structural integrity. Beyond these, molybdenum’s role in powder metallurgy enables the creation of complex shapes with precise properties – a benefit crucial for many advanced technologies. Ultimately, careful selection and application of molybdenum materials yield significant improvements in operational reliability and product longevity.
